critical anthelmintic trials in ponies with oxfendazole and caviphos and concomitant studies on the spontaneous elimination of small strongylids.the efficacy of the benzimidazole, oxfendazole, and the organophosphate, caviphos, against gastrointestinal parasites of ponies was evaluated by the critcial test method. oxfendazole (10 mg/kg of body weight) given in single oral doses was 100% effective against adult large strongylids (strongylus vulgaris, strongylus edentatus, and strongylus equinus), 99% effective against adult small strongylids, and 97% effective against 4th-stage small strongylids (genera identified in order of frequency: c ...1979475090
critical tests of the antiparasitic activity of thiabendazole and trichlorfon sequentially administered to horses via stomach tube.thirteen critical tests were conducted in horses naturally infected with helminths and bots. single doses of thiabendazole (44 mg/kg of body weight) and trichlorfon (40 mg/kg of body weight) powder formulations were administered as suspensions sequentially given via stomach tube to evaluate the efficacy of the combination against the large parasites of horses. parasite removal efficacies were 100% against 2nd instar gasterophilus intestinalis and 2nd and 3rd instar gasterophilus nasalis and 82 t ...1977879569
critical tests of anthelmintic activity of a paste formulation of thiabendazole in horses.critical tests of the activity on large strongyles, ascarids, mature pinworms, and bots were carried out in 11 horses intraorally treated with a paste formulation of thiabendazole. the dose level of 44 mg/kg was administered to 3 horses, and the dose level of 88 mg/kg to 8 horses. removals of strongylus vulgaris and mature oxyuris equi were 100% at the 2 dose levels, and efficacy against strongylus edentatus varied from 95 to 99% and 89 to 100% for the 44- and the 88-mg/kg dose levels, respectiv ...1976937790
necropsies of eight horses infected with strongylus equinus and strongylus edentatus.ponies (n = 8) approximately 18 months old, were infected with 20,000 to 30,000 infective larvae of strongylus equinus with less than 10% contamination with strongylus edentatus larvae and necropsied 7 months post-infection. lesions were present in the omentum, liver, pancreas, ventral colon, caecum and occasionally in the lungs. there were numerous intraabdominal adhesions and severe multiple granulomatous omentitis. pancreatic damage, which characterises s. equinus, was exceptionally mild and ...19921501210
internal parasites of horses on mixed grassveld and bushveld in transvaal, republic of south africa.between 1980 and 1982, the gastrointestinal tracts of 17 horses which had been grazing on mixed grassveld at potchefstroom and bushveld at onderstepoort in the province of transvaal, republic of south africa, were examined at necropsy and processed for parasite recovery. the large strongyles and their prevalences were as follows: strongylus vulgaris and associated lesions (88-94%), strongylus edentatus (24%), strongylus equinus (30%), triodontophorus nipponicus (35%) and craterostomum acuticauda ...19892588465
chronic eosinophilic pancreatitis and ulcerative colitis in a horse.a generalized debilitating disease in a horse was believed to be related to hypersensitivity to migrating strongyle larvae. the clinical signs included weight loss, diarrhea, and ulcers on all 4 coronary bands. the mare's condition deteriorated rapidly, so the mare was euthanatized and necropsied. the major histopathologic findings were chronic multifocal eosinophilic pancreatitis, hepatic portal fibrosis, biliary hyperplasia, and chronic ulcerative eosinophilic colitis. this case was similar to ...19853997643

anthelmintic efficacy fenbendazole paste in equines.a single oral dose of fenbendazole (fbz) paste at 7,5 mg/kg body mass was given to 5 horses. it was highly effective against adults of the following genera: cyathostomum, cylicostephanus, cylicondontophorus, poteriostomum, cylicocyclus, triodontophorus, oesophagodontus (and other genera belonging to the subfamily cyathostominae). similarly, high efficacy was obtained against the adults of the following species: oxyuris equi, strongylus vulgaris, strongylus equinus and probstmayria vivipara. thes ...19817277372
in vitro culture of equine strongylidae to the fourth larval stage in a cell-free medium.an efficient and reliable method is described for the culture of equine strongyles from the third (l3) to the fourth (l4) larval stage. medium consists of 50% fetal calf serum and 50% nctc with additions of l-glutamine, nahco3, yeast extract, bactopeptone, and dextrose. the gas phase used is of prime importance; it is a mixture of 10% co2, 5% o2, and 85% n2. strongylus vulgaris, strongylus edentatus, strongylus equinus, triodontophorus brevicauda, triodontophorus serratus, triodontophorus tenuic ...19948158465

anthelmintic efficacies of a tablet formula of ivermectin-praziquantel on horses experimentally infected with three strongylus species.in this blinded randomized and controlled study, the anthelmintic efficacy of a tablet formula of ivermectin-praziquantel was evaluated in horses experimentally infected with three species of strongylus larvae. eighteen previously dewormed horses were inoculated on study day 0 with third-stage larvae of strongylus vulgaris, strongylus equinus, and strongylus edentatus. the horses were randomly allocated to three groups (n = 6): test-drug (tablet formula), positive-control (reference gel), and ne ...200919488785

role of lipids in the transmission of the infective stage (l3) of strongylus vulgaris (nematoda: strongylida).infective larvae (l3) of strongylus vulgaris have limited energy stores for host finding and for infection. for transmission to occur, the larvae must have sufficient energy to (a) migrate onto grass, where they are ingested by their equine host (host finding), and (b) penetrate into the host gut. this study is designed to test the hypothesis that l3 larvae of s. vulgaris partition their energy stores between locomotory activity (used in host finding) and infection activity (penetration). chroni ...19979379277
strongylus equinus: development and pathological effects in the equine host.the development and pathological effects of strongylus equinus were studied in 17 pony foals and one horse foal raised in isolation and examined at necropsy from seven days to 40 wk postinfection (pi). following inoculation of 15000 +/- 6% or 16000 +/- 6% infective larvae by stomach tube foals were monitored for clinical signs and selected blood changes. larvae penetrated the wall of the ileum, cecum and colon. the molt to the fourth stage occurred mostly in the wall of the ventral colon before ...19854075237
in vitro development of strongylus edentatus to the fourth larval stage with notes on strongylus vulgaris and strongylus equinus.strongylus edentatus was successfully cultured in vitro to the fourth larval stage (l4). some growth continued for periods of 40-50 days at which time reductions in viability were observed in some of the culture systems tested. various combinations of media, sera, buffers and organ explant cultures were tested. all cultures were incubated at 37 c in an atmosphere of 95% air and 5% co2. larvae underwent growth and differentiation to the l4 in all medium-serum combinations with and without organ e ...19854032151

the complete mitochondrial genome of strongylus equinus (chromadorea: strongylidae): comparison with other closely related species and phylogenetic analyses.the roundworms of genus strongylus are the common parasitic nematodes in the large intestine of equine, causing significant economic losses to the livestock industries. in spite of its importance, the genetic data and epidemiology of this parasite are not entirely understood. in the present study, the complete s. equinus mitochondrial (mt) genome was determined. the length of s. equinus mt genome dna sequence is 14,545 bp, containing 36 genes, of which 12 code for protein, 22 for transfer rna, a ...201526366671
